Sodexo is seeking an experienced, high-energy Resident District Manager to lead dining services at Washington University in St. Louis, MO. This role oversees up to a $20M operation, managing over 200 employees in a unionized environment across a range of dining, retail, and catering services. The ideal candidate will be a strategic, innovative leader focused on delivering high-quality service and enhancing student and customer engagement, while aligning with client goals. Situated in a vibrant cultural hub with excellent transit access, this opportunity calls for someone with proven success in large, complex food service operations and a passion for excellence. Lead a large-scale, multi-unit dining operation with strategic vision
Develop and maintain strong client relationships to align with institutional goals
Ensure consistent, high-quality food service and exceptional customer experience
Drive employee engagement, training, and development in a union setting
Manage financial performance, including budget oversight and cost controls
Deliver innovative dining programs and high-end catering solutions

5+ years of consecutive experience managing high-volume food service operations
Expertise in P&L management and delivering financial accountability
Proven leadership in complex environments with diverse teams
Strong focus on food quality, safety, and regulatory compliance
Excellent interpersonal and communication skills across all organizational levels
Passion for innovation, student engagement, and continuous improvement
